Microbix Biosystems (TSE:MBX) Shares Down 4.8%

Microbix Biosystems Inc. (TSE:MBXGet Free Report) shares traded down 4.8% on Friday . The company traded as low as C$0.30 and last traded at C$0.30. 187,287 shares traded h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 179% from the average session volume of 67,151 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$0.32.

Microbix Biosystems Stock Down 4.8 %

The company has a quick ratio of 5.57, a current ratio of 8.53 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 24.53. The firm has a market capitalization of C$41.23 million, a PE ratio of 10.50 and a beta of 0.25. The business’s 50-day moving average price is C$0.33 and its 200-day moving average price is C$0.37.

Microbix Biosystems Inc, a life science company, develops and commercializes proprietary biological and technological solutions for human health and wellbeing in North America, Europe, and internationally. The company manufactures diagnostic-test products, such as test-controls under the QAPs brand; viral transport medium for collection of patient samples to test for pathogens including virus causing the COVID-19 disease under the DxTM brand; Kinlytic, a biologic thrombolytic drug used to treat blood clots; and antigen products.
